Fellow, Client & Graphics Technology
THE ROLE:
AMD is seeking key technical talent that is focused on identifying new technologies and use cases that can be developed for our Client and Computing Graphics product roadmaps.
THE PERSON:
The technical leader will have experience working in the semiconductor market for Client and/or Graphics in technology identification, pathfinding, and incubation. He/she will have deep knowledge of the OEM / ODM ecosystems.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Work within the geographical region to identify technology and use cases that can be developed for Client and Computing Graphics (CG) products
- The technologies will span both hardware and software and will be sourced from academia, startups, established companies and ODM/OEM innovation labs.
- Researching technologies that could be an inflection point, a technology that could have significant impact on client and computing graphics products either design or use or both.
- Lead the development of POCs to aid in determining if a technology or use case is applicable to AMD’s Client and CG roadmaps.
PREFERRED EXPERIENCE:
- Extensive experience in the semiconductor experience, particularly in relation to client computing devices (laptop, desktop, notebook/Chromebook, workstations, gaming) or graphics/GPU computing related.
- Experience in the identification and incubation of leading/inflection point technologies within the Client or Computing graphics area.
- Deep knowledge of OEM/ODM ecosystems.
- Adept at collaboration among top-thinkers and technology leaders across teams in different geographies.
- Strong ver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ills with both technical and non-technical audiences
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S:
Bachelor's degree in electrical engineering or related field; advanced degree preferred
LOCATION:
Taipei, Taiwan/Singapore
